Hey Tomas,

Handover notes before your shift: the Larkspur component library cut a new major version on Friday, and a few product teams haven't bumped yet. Support team — if tickets mention broken buttons or weird spacing, it's almost certainly a v4/v5 mismatch, not a real bug. Point folks to the migration guide in the Larkspur docs. For anything gnarlier, the design systems crew can be reached here.

escalation mailbox, bafog-fafog: ulador@paliqlabs.internal

Warranty claims on the Corvale range have exceeded the annual provision by roughly 40 percent, driven by a faulty heating element sourced from a single supplier. The service network in the Dellbrook region is absorbing most of the volume. Corrective actions: supplier change completed, revised provision booked, extended-repair programme launched. Residual exposure is expected to taper over two quarters. Your review should focus on supplier governance. The forward plan is summarised below.

board note of tadup-tajog: Headcount on the Oliiel team goes from 31 to 88 by the end of February. Gross margin on Oliiel came in at 62 percent against a plan of 29 percent.

Minutes — Management Meeting, Capacity Review

Present: Orla Fenwick (Ops), Dessa Rourke (Sales), Tomas Vael (Finance). Orla presented utilisation data for the Glenharrow facility, confirming sustained demand for the Ardent line exceeds current throughput. After discussion, the group approved a phased expansion rather than outsourcing to Pellway Fabrication. Sales leads should set customer lead-time expectations accordingly. The following confidential note informed the decision.

confidential, fahip-bagep: The southern region missed its Holwyn quota by 21.5 percent last quarter. Sorvanek Foods plans to raise the Jorir list price by 23.9 percent in December. The pricing group signed off on a budget of $411.6 million for Project Eliion. The renewal with Juldorix Works closes at $87.9 million a year, 16.8 percent below the last contract.

## Welcome to Pellet Cache

Hey! Pellet sits a bloom filter in front of our Korvax key-value store so we skip disk hits for keys that definitely don't exist. Rebuilds run nightly; if the filter file corrupts, delete it and restart — it'll regenerate. To unlock the rebuild admin console, use the passphrase below.

unlock words, fafop-hawep: briwyn-oliix-sorox